INSTANT HONEYMOON We'd been courting four years. Nita was a nervous wreck. There were health problems. Insecurities. Doubts on both sides. We had both been married before. We weren't going to roll the dice like over-amped teenagers. I questioned the logic of taking this enormous leap. I felt like I was walking into a windmill. I was moving eight-hundred miles from L.A., leaving my life's work, my friends, and the comfort of familiar surroundings. There was only one reality: we loved each other. Despite an anguished week of stress and uncertainty, the marriage went beautifully. Nita smiled ...
